You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@karaf.apache.org by jb...@apache.org on 2014/01/10 15:44:18 UTC

[1/2] git commit: [KARAF-2666] Add hibernate 3 enterprise features

Updated Branches:
  refs/heads/karaf-2.3.x bb3ac068d -> 2423ba782


[KARAF-2666] Add hibernate 3 enterprise features


Project: http://git-wip-us.apache.org/repos/asf/karaf/repo
Commit: http://git-wip-us.apache.org/repos/asf/karaf/commit/dfb8f6c4
Tree: http://git-wip-us.apache.org/repos/asf/karaf/tree/dfb8f6c4
Diff: http://git-wip-us.apache.org/repos/asf/karaf/diff/dfb8f6c4

Branch: refs/heads/karaf-2.3.x
Commit: dfb8f6c41801c103eac134c5277d65e5a4675a05
Parents: d3b0506
Author: Jean-Baptiste Onofré <jb...@apache.org>
Authored: Fri Jan 10 15:43:20 2014 +0100
Committer: Jean-Baptiste Onofré <jb...@apache.org>
Committed: Fri Jan 10 15:43:20 2014 +0100

----------------------------------------------------------------------
 .../enterprise/src/main/resources/features.xml    | 18 ++++++++++++++++++
 pom.xml                                           | 14 +++++++++++++-
 2 files changed, 31 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/karaf/blob/dfb8f6c4/assemblies/features/enterprise/src/main/resources/features.xml
----------------------------------------------------------------------
diff --git a/assemblies/features/enterprise/src/main/resources/features.xml b/assemblies/features/enterprise/src/main/resources/features.xml
index a5fd625..0c2b43b 100644
--- a/assemblies/features/enterprise/src/main/resources/features.xml
+++ b/assemblies/features/enterprise/src/main/resources/features.xml
@@ -57,6 +57,24 @@
         <bundle>mvn:org.apache.openjpa/openjpa/${openjpa.version}</bundle>
     </feature>
 
+    <feature name="hibernate" description="Hibernate 3.x JPA persistence engine support" version="${hibernate3.version}" resolver="(obr)">
+        <details>Enable Hibernate 3.x as persistence engine.</details>
+        <feature>jpa</feature>
+        <bundle dependency="true">mvn:org.apache.servicemix.specs/org.apache.servicemix.specs.java-persistence-api-1.1.1/${servicemix.specs.version}</bundle>
+        <bundle dependency="true">mvn:commons-collections/commons-collections/${commons-collections.version}</bundle>
+        <bundle dependency="true">mvn:commons-pool/commons-pool/${commons-pool.version}</bundle>
+        <bundle dependency="true">mvn:commons-dbcp/commons-dbcp/${commons-dbcp.version}</bundle>
+        <bundle dependency="true">mvn:org.apache.servicemix.bundles/org.apache.servicemix.bundles.dom4j/${dom4j.bundle.version}</bundle>
+        <bundle dependency="true">mvn:org.objectweb.asm/com.springsource.org.objectweb.asm/${asm.springsource.version}</bundle>
+        <bundle dependency="true">mvn:org.apache.servicemix.bundles/org.apache.servicemix.bundles.antlr/${antlr.bundle.version}</bundle>
+        <bundle dependency="true">mvn:org.apache.servicemix.bundles/org.apache.servicemix.bundles.cglib/${cglib.bundle.version}</bundle>
+        <bundle dependency="true">mvn:org.jboss.javassist/com.springsource.javassist/${javassist.version}</bundle>
+        <bundle>mvn:org.hibernate/com.springsource.org.hibernate.annotations.common/${hibernate.annotations.common.version}</bundle>
+        <bundle>mvn:org.hibernate/com.springsource.org.hibernate.annotations/${hibernate.annotations.version}</bundle>
+        <bundle>mvn:org.hibernate/com.springsource.org.hibernate.ejb/${hibernate.ejb.version}</bundle>
+        <bundle>mvn:org.hibernate/com.springsource.org.hibernate/${hibernate3.version}</bundle>
+    </feature>
+
     <feature name="jndi" description="OSGi Service Registry JNDI access" version="${aries.jndi.version}" resolver="(obr)">
         <details>JNDI support provided by Apache Aries JNDI ${aries.jndi.version}</details>
         <bundle start-level="30">mvn:org.apache.aries.jndi/org.apache.aries.jndi.api/${aries.jndi.api.version}</bundle>

http://git-wip-us.apache.org/repos/asf/karaf/blob/dfb8f6c4/pom.xml
----------------------------------------------------------------------
diff --git a/pom.xml b/pom.xml
index db62d4d..c618f36 100644
--- a/pom.xml
+++ b/pom.xml
@@ -103,7 +103,9 @@
 
     <properties>
         <aopalliance.bundle.version>1.0_6</aopalliance.bundle.version>
+        <antlr.bundle.version>2.7.7_5</antlr.bundle.version>
         <asm.version>4.1</asm.version>
+        <asm.springsource.version>1.5.3</asm.springsource.version>
         <bndlib.version>1.50.0</bndlib.version>
         <cglib.bundle.version>2.2.2_1</cglib.bundle.version>
         <commons-beanutils.version>1.8.3</commons-beanutils.version>
@@ -115,12 +117,16 @@
         <commons-io.version>2.4</commons-io.version>
         <commons-lang.version>2.6</commons-lang.version>
         <commons-pool.version>1.6</commons-pool.version>
+        <dom4j.bundle.version>1.6.1_5</dom4j.bundle.version>
         <injection.bundle.version>1.0</injection.bundle.version>
         <jasypt.bundle.version>1.9.1_1</jasypt.bundle.version>
+        <javassist.version>3.9.0.GA</javassist.version>
         <jetty.version>7.6.8.v20121106</jetty.version>
         <junit.version>4.10</junit.version>
         <junit.bundle.version>4.10_1</junit.bundle.version>
         <org.json.version>20131018</org.json.version>
+        <geronimo.annotation-spec.version>1.0.1</geronimo.annotation-spec.version>
+        <geronimo.jaspic-spec.version>1.1</geronimo.jaspic-spec.version>
         <geronimo.jms-spec.version>1.1.1</geronimo.jms-spec.version>
         <geronimo.jpa-spec.version>1.1</geronimo.jpa-spec.version>
         <geronimo.jta-spec.version>1.1.1</geronimo.jta-spec.version>
@@ -142,6 +148,12 @@
         <felix.obr.version>1.0.2</felix.obr.version>
         <felix.scr.version>1.8.0</felix.scr.version>
         <felix.scr.webconsole.plugin.version>1.0.0</felix.scr.webconsole.plugin.version>
+
+        <hibernate.annotations.common.version>3.3.0.ga</hibernate.annotations.common.version>
+        <hibernate.annotations.version>3.4.0.GA</hibernate.annotations.version>
+        <hibernate.ejb.version>3.4.0.GA</hibernate.ejb.version>
+        <hibernate3.version>3.3.2.GA</hibernate3.version>
+
         <aries.application.version>1.0.0</aries.application.version>
         <aries.application.api.version>1.0.0</aries.application.api.version>
         <aries.application.management.version>1.0.0</aries.application.management.version>
@@ -188,7 +200,7 @@
         <portlet-api.version>2.0</portlet-api.version>
         <servicemix.specs.version>2.4.0</servicemix.specs.version>
         <servlet.api.version>2.5</servlet.api.version>
-        <slf4j.version>1.7.2</slf4j.version>
+        <slf4j.version>1.7.5</slf4j.version>
         <spring.osgi.version>1.2.1</spring.osgi.version>
         <spring2.version>2.5.6.SEC03</spring2.version>
         <spring30.version>3.0.7.RELEASE</spring30.version>


[2/2] git commit: Merge branch 'karaf-2.3.x' of https://git-wip-us.apache.org/repos/asf/karaf into karaf-2.3.x

Posted by jb...@apache.org.
Merge branch 'karaf-2.3.x' of https://git-wip-us.apache.org/repos/asf/karaf into karaf-2.3.x


Project: http://git-wip-us.apache.org/repos/asf/karaf/repo
Commit: http://git-wip-us.apache.org/repos/asf/karaf/commit/2423ba78
Tree: http://git-wip-us.apache.org/repos/asf/karaf/tree/2423ba78
Diff: http://git-wip-us.apache.org/repos/asf/karaf/diff/2423ba78

Branch: refs/heads/karaf-2.3.x
Commit: 2423ba782e659e249e35cae5545661bbcfc0a87f
Parents: dfb8f6c bb3ac06
Author: Jean-Baptiste Onofré <jb...@apache.org>
Authored: Fri Jan 10 15:44:00 2014 +0100
Committer: Jean-Baptiste Onofré <jb...@apache.org>
Committed: Fri Jan 10 15:44:00 2014 +0100

----------------------------------------------------------------------
 .../java/org/apache/karaf/admin/internal/AdminServiceImpl.java   | 4 ++++
 1 file changed, 4 insertions(+)
----------------------------------------------------------------------